Jeff Wise / Gizmodo:
Exclusive: John McAfee Wanted for Murder (Updated)  —  Antivirus pioneer John McAfee is on the run from murder charges, Belize police say.  According to Marco Vidal, head of the national police force's Gang Suppression Unit, McAfee is a prime suspect in the murder of American expatriate Gregory Faull …

Sara Forden / Bloomberg:
Google Said to Face Ultimatum From FTC in Antitrust Talks  —  Google Inc. (GOOG) is being pressed by U.S. Federal Trade Commission Chairman Jonathan Leibowitz to make an offer to settle the agency's antitrust investigation in the next few days or face a formal complaint, two people familiar with the situation said.

Robin Wauters / The Next Web:
j2 Global buys tech media company Ziff Davis for $167 million in cash  —  Well, well, well.  It turns out Ziff Davis will live on to die another day.  The technology media company has been acquired by j2 Global, a business cloud services provider, for roughly $167 million in cash on hand.
